import { assert } from 'chai';
import { addStage, Konva } from './test-utils.ts';
describe('Animation', function () {
// ======================================================
it('test start and stop', function () {
var stage = addStage();
var layer = new Konva.Layer();
var rect = new Konva.Rect({
x: 200,
y: 100,
width: 100,
height: 50,
fill: 'green',
stroke: 'black',
strokeWidth: 4,
});
layer.add(rect);
stage.add(layer);
var amplitude = 150;
var period = 1000;
// in ms
var centerX = stage.width() / 2 - 100 / 2;
var anim = new Konva.Animation(function (frame) {
rect.x(
amplitude * Math.sin((frame.time * 2 * Math.PI) / period) + centerX
);
}, layer);
var a = Konva.Animation.animations;
var startLen = a.length;
assert.equal(a.length, startLen, '1should be no animations running');
anim.start();
assert.equal(a.length, startLen + 1, '2should be 1 animation running');
anim.stop();
assert.equal(a.length, startLen, '3should be no animations running');
anim.start();
assert.equal(a.length, startLen + 1, '4should be 1 animation running');
anim.start();
assert.equal(a.length, startLen + 1, '5should be 1 animation runningg');
anim.stop();
assert.equal(a.length, startLen, '6should be no animations running');
anim.stop();
assert.equal(a.length, startLen, '7should be no animations running');
});
// ======================================================
it('layer batch draw', function () {
var stage = addStage();
var layer = new Konva.Layer();
var rect = new Konva.Rect({
x: 200,
y: 100,
width: 100,
height: 50,
fill: 'green',
stroke: 'black',
strokeWidth: 4,
});
layer.add(rect);
stage.add(layer);
var draws = 0;
layer.on('draw', function () {
//console.log('draw')
draws++;
});
layer.draw();
layer.draw();
layer.draw();
assert.equal(draws, 3, 'draw count should be 3');
layer.batchDraw();
layer.batchDraw();
layer.batchDraw();
assert.notEqual(draws, 6, 'should not be 6 draws');
});
// ======================================================
it('stage batch draw', function () {
var stage = addStage();
var layer = new Konva.Layer();
var rect = new Konva.Rect({
x: 200,
y: 100,
width: 100,
height: 50,
fill: 'green',
stroke: 'black',
strokeWidth: 4,
});
layer.add(rect);
stage.add(layer);
var draws = 0;
layer.on('draw', function () {
//console.log('draw')
draws++;
});
stage.draw();
stage.draw();
stage.draw();
assert.equal(draws, 3, 'draw count should be 3');
stage.batchDraw();
stage.batchDraw();
stage.batchDraw();
assert.notEqual(draws, 6, 'should not be 6 draws');
});
});
